囲第1項、第2項又は第3項記−載の微小回転装置。[Claims for Utility Model Registration] 1. An element formed by laminating a plurality of piezoelectric ceramic plates polarized in the thickness direction and provided with electrodes, and a plurality of laminated piezoelectric ceramic plates polarized in the direction perpendicular to the thickness and provided with electrodes. 1. A micro-rotating device characterized in that a laminated element, which is a combination of elements made of 2. The micro-rotation device according to claim 1, which is a registered utility model, wherein the laminated element is fixed to the shaft or cylindrical body and the cylindrical body or shaft is rotationally driven. 3. The micro-rotation device according to claim 1 or 2 of the utility model registration claim, in which linear laminated elements are provided radially together with the laminated elements. 4. The micro-rotation device according to claim 1, 2, or 3 of the utility model registration claim, wherein reverse-direction laminated elements acting in a direction opposite to the combined displacement direction of the laminated elements are radially provided.
